using System;using System.Drawing;using System.Windows.Forms;namespace Whatever{ class ComboBoxWrap : ComboBox { public ComboBoxWrap() : base() { // add event handlers this.DrawMode = System.Windows.Forms.DrawMode.OwnerDrawVariable; this.DrawItem += new DrawItemEventHandler(ComboBoxWrap_DrawItem); this.MeasureItem += new MeasureItemEventHandler(ComboBoxWrap_MeasureItem); } void ComboBoxWrap_MeasureItem(object sender, MeasureItemEventArgs e) { // set the height of the item, using MeasureString with the font and control width ComboBoxWrap ddl = (ComboBoxWrap)sender; string text = ddl.Items[e.Index].ToString(); SizeF size = e.Graphics.MeasureString(text.ToString(), this.Font, ddl.Width); e.ItemHeight = (int)Math.Ceiling(size.Height) + 1; // plus one for the border } void ComboBoxWrap_DrawItem(object sender, DrawItemEventArgs e) { if (e.Index < 0) return; // draw a lighter blue selected BG colour, the dark blue default has poor contrast with black text on a dark blue background if ((e.State & DrawItemState.Selected) == DrawItemState.Selected) e.Graphics.FillRectangle(Brushes.PowderBlue, e.Bounds); else e.Graphics.FillRectangle(Brushes.White, e.Bounds); // get the text of the item ComboBoxWrap ddl = (ComboBoxWrap)sender; string text = ddl.Items[e.Index].ToString(); // don't dispose the brush afterwards Brush b = Brushes.Black; e.Graphics.DrawString(text, this.Font, b, e.Bounds, StringFormat.GenericDefault); // draw a light grey border line to separate the items Pen p = new Pen(Brushes.Gainsboro, 1); e.Graphics.DrawLine(p, new Point(e.Bounds.Left, e.Bounds.Bottom-1), new Point(e.Bounds.Right, e.Bounds.Bottom-1)); p.Dispose(); e.DrawFocusRectangle(); } }}
